/*
In Cygwin, there is no support for fseeko(). We can use fseek() on a 64-bit
distribution of Cygwin, because a signed long int has sufficient bits to store
an offset for a file greater than 2 GB. For 32-bit distributions of Cygwin, we
do not yet have support for this arrangement.
*/
#ifdef __CYGWIN__
#define fseeko fseek
#endif
#ifdef __CYGWIN32__
#error 32-bit Cygwin compilation is unsupported due to lack of fseeko() support
#endif
